mcberko (47456) reviewed Farmer's Daughter from The Beer Farmers 7 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 6 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 6 | Overall - 7
On tap at The Beer Horse, pours a cloudy golden with a small white head. Aroma brings out cloves, saison yeast, and biscuity malt. Flavour has spicy clove, saison yeast and dry biscuity malt. Spicy and dry. Good stuff.
mcberko (47456) reviewed Draft Horse Ale from The Beer Farmers 7 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 5 | Flavor - 5 | Texture - 4 | Overall - 5.5
On tap at The Beer Horse, pours a clear copper with a small white head. Aroma brings out biscuity malt, nor much hops. Flavour is along the same lines, with some subtle fruitiness, bready malt, and a bit of citrus hops. It's clean and decently balanced. Decent.
mcberko (47456) reviewed Locals Only Lager from The Beer Farmers 7 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 5 | Flavor - 5 | Texture - 4 | Overall - 6
On tap at The Beer Horse, pours a clear golden with a small white head. Aroma brings out straw, grainy mineraly notes, and toasted biscuity malt. Flavour is clean, with grassiness and toasted biscuity malt. Clean and easy, but nothing special.
